isvalid

Класс: указатель

Определите допустимые указатели

Синтаксис

B = isvalid(H)

Описание

B = isvalid(H) возвращает логический массив, в котором каждым элементом является true если соответствующий элемент в H допустимый указатель. Переменная указателя становится недопустимой, если объект был удален. В классе delete метод, isvalid всегда возвращает false.

Вы не можете заменить isvalid метод в handle подклассы.

Входные параметры

развернуть все

Входной массив, заданный как массив указателей на объект.

Выходные аргументы

развернуть все

Результат теста валидности, возвращенного как логический массив тот же размер как H в котором каждым элементом является true если соответствующий элемент в H допустимый указатель.

Примеры

Тестирование на допустимые указатели

Этот пример тестирует массив указателя на допустимых участников:

H = plot(rand(5));
delete(H(3:4))
B = isvalid(H)
B =

     1
     1
     0
     0
     1